TURN-208: Gatevale turnstile counters at the Merrow Field pilot double-count when a rotation reverses mid-cycle. Attendance totals drift roughly 2% high per event. The debounce window fix is implemented, reviewed by Ilsa, and soak-tested across two simulated match days without drift. Ready for your cut; the candidate build is identified below.

trace token, tagag-tafog: htk6_5ed18c

If a Brindlewick worker starts refusing connections with "too many open files," do not restart it immediately — we lose the evidence. First, capture the descriptor table of the suspect process and note which paths or sockets dominate. Compare against a healthy peer; a leak usually shows thousands of entries pointing at the same spool directory. Record your findings in the incident channel before recycling the node. The full capture procedure, with annotated examples from past hunts, is documented here.

operations page: https://confluence.qorvellabs.internal/pages/projects/projects/projects

QUOTA-218: per-tenant rate quotas reset early on Meridock

Hey reviewers — quotas for tenant buckets are resetting at 50 minutes instead of 60.

Repro:
1. Create tenant with a 100 req/hr quota on staging.
2. Burn the quota with the loadgen script.
3. Wait 50 min, send one request — it succeeds (shouldn't).

Looks like the window math uses the wrong epoch. To hit the staging quota endpoint yourself, auth with the token below.

login token, bagug-kafop: eyJhbGciOiJIUzI1NiIsInR5cCI6IkpXVCJ9.eyJzdWIiOiIcMLov2In0.Z5RLDIfp